Best Diving in Mexico: Ultimate Guide to Top Sites & Marine Life

Let's be honest, when you think of world-class diving, Mexico just keeps popping up, doesn't it? You've probably seen those impossibly blue water photos from Cozumel or heard whispers about diving in caves filled with light beams. But with so much coastline and so many options, figuring out where to go for the absolute best diving in Mexico can feel overwhelming. Is it the Caribbean side with its warm, calm waters and turtles? The Pacific with its big animal action? Or those mysterious inland cenotes?

I've been diving here for years, hopping between coasts, and I've had my share of both breathtaking moments and a few letdowns. This guide isn't just a list. It's meant to cut through the noise and help you find your kind of perfect dive, whether you're a newbie putting on a BCD for the tenth time or a seasoned pro looking for a new thrill.best diving in Mexico

The Quick Take: Mexico offers two radically different diving worlds. The Caribbean (Quintana Roo) is your postcard-perfect reef diving—warm, clear, full of color and life. The Pacific (Baja California, Revillagigedo) is wilder, colder, and about epic pelagic encounters. And then there are the cenotes, which are in a league of their own. The "best" spot entirely depends on what you're after.

Why Mexico is a Diver's Dream (And Sometimes a Headache)

The diversity is just insane. Where else can you drift over a vibrant coral wall in the morning and then, in the afternoon, descend into a freshwater cavern where sunlight filters through the jungle floor above? Or spend a week swimming with sea lions in playful kelp forests? The logistical ease is a huge plus too. Many of the best diving spots in Mexico are a short flight and a quick boat ride away from major airports, with infrastructure that ranges from rustic dive shacks to full-blown luxury liveaboards.

A word of caution though—popularity has its price. Some sites, especially near Cancun and Cozumel, can get crowded. I've been on boats where it felt like we were following a conga line of divers. It takes away from the magic. Picking the right time of year and operator is crucial.

But when you get it right, it's pure magic. The water is warm enough that a 3mm wetsuit often suffices (except in the Pacific, where you'll want a 5mm or 7mm). The marine life is used to people, often making for great encounters. And let's not forget the post-dive tacos and cold cerveza—a ritual that somehow makes the diving even better.Mexico diving spots

The Top Contenders: Where to Find the Best Diving in Mexico

We need to break this down by region, because they're so different. Trying to compare Cozumel to Socorro is like comparing a serene forest hike to climbing a mountain.

The Caribbean Crown Jewels: Cozumel & the Riviera Maya

This is where most people start their search for the best diving in Mexico, and for good reason. The Mesoamerican Barrier Reef System, the second-largest in the world, runs right along here. The water is bathwater warm (78-84°F / 25-29°C year-round), visibility often exceeds 100 feet, and the current... well, the current is the whole point in some places.

Cozumel: The undisputed king of Caribbean diving in Mexico. This island is all about the drift dive. You jump in, get carried along by a gentle current, and fly over stunning coral formations like Palancar and Columbia Reefs. It's effortless and mesmerizing. You'll see enormous sponges in yellows and purples, endless schools of grunts and snappers, eagle rays gliding by, and if you're lucky, the occasional turtle or nurse shark napping under a ledge. The town of San Miguel is 100% built around diving, which has pros (everyone speaks "diver") and cons (it can feel touristy).

My Personal Take: Cozumel delivers consistently great, easy diving. But for me, the real magic happens on the less-visited southern reefs. Ask your operator about sites like Maracaibo or Devil's Throat for something more adventurous.

Playa del Carmen & Tulum: The mainland coast offers a different vibe. The reef is closer to shore, so dives are often shorter boat rides. The big draw here is the bull shark season (roughly November to March), where you can do specialized dives to see these powerful predators. Then, of course, there's the gateway to the cenotes. Playa is a bustling town with a great food scene, while Tulum is more boho-chic (and pricier).scuba diving Mexico

The Pacific Powerhouses: Baja California & Beyond

Swap crystal-clear calm for raw, oceanic power. The Pacific side is for divers who want adrenaline and big animal encounters. The water is cooler (can be as low as 60°F / 16°C in winter), visibility is more variable (anywhere from 30 to 80 feet), but the payoff can be unbelievable.

Sea of Cortez (La Paz & Loreto): Called "the aquarium of the world" by Jacques Cousteau. La Paz is famous for its playful sea lion colonies at Los Islotes. Diving with them is like being in a puppy park underwater—they'll zoom around, blow bubbles in your face, and nibble your fins. You also have a good chance of finding whale sharks (surface snorkeling) from October to April. Loreto offers more remote island diving with healthy reefs. It's quieter and less developed.

Revillagigedo Archipelago (Socorro Islands): This is bucket-list, liveaboard-only territory. Located about 250 miles off the tip of Baja, "Socorro" is Mexico's answer to Cocos Island or the Galapagos. We're talking about guaranteed encounters with giant manta rays (some with wingspans over 20 feet) that will circle you for bubble baths. You'll see hundreds of sharks—silvertips, Galapagos, hammerheads, and sometimes tiger sharks. Dolphins, humpback whales (in season), and huge tuna schools are common. It's not cheap, and the crossings can be rough, but it's arguably some of the most epic best diving in Mexico, period. You need to be an experienced diver with good buoyancy control for this one.

A Reality Check: Socorro trips are a major investment of time and money (often 10+ days). The seas can be seriously rough. If you get seasick, this might not be for you, no matter how amazing the diving is. I've seen tough divers laid low by the crossing.

The Unique World: Cenotes of the Yucatán

This isn't ocean diving. It's freshwater cave diving, but don't panic—most cenote dives are conducted in the "cavern zone," where you always have direct sight of natural light and the entrance. You need a special guide (a full cave certification is required to go further). The experience is surreal. You dive in crystal-clear freshwater, navigating through caverns adorned with stalactites and stalagmites. Sunlight pierces through holes in the ceiling, creating dramatic light beams ("haloclines" where salt and freshwater meet can create a surreal, blurry effect). It's incredibly peaceful and otherworldly. Popular entry-level cenotes for divers include Dos Ojos, The Pit, and Carwash. It's a must-do to complete the Mexican diving trifecta.best diving in Mexico

How to Choose Your Best Diving in Mexico Spot (A Practical Table)

Still torn? This might help. Think about what you really want from your trip.

Destination Best For Water Temp & Vis Marine Life Highlights Skill Level
Cozumel Easy, scenic drift diving; vibrant coral reefs; relaxed vacation vibe. Warm (78-84°F). Excellent vis (80-150ft). Turtles, eagle rays, nurse sharks, massive sponges, schooling fish. Beginner to Advanced (some deep drifts).
Playa del Carmen/Tulum Combining reef dives with cenotes; bull shark action (seasonal); nightlife/food. Warm (78-84°F). Good vis (50-100ft). Cenotes: fresh, 70+ ft vis. Reef life, bull sharks, cenote formations. Beginner to Intermediate (cenotes require guide).
Sea of Cortez (La Paz) Playful animal interactions; whale sharks; a more "local" Mexican feel. Cooler (65-80°F). Variable vis (30-70ft). Sea lions, whale sharks (snorkel), mobula rays, sometimes whales. Beginner to Intermediate.
Revillagigedo (Socorro) Big animal pelagic action; adventure; bucket-list diving. Cool (60-75°F). Variable vis (40-80ft). Can be strong currents. Giant mantas, many shark species, dolphins, humpback whales. Advanced only. Strong currents, deep, liveaboard.
Cenotes Unique geological formations; amazing light effects; absolute tranquility. Freshwater, cool (75°F). Phenomenal vis (100ft+). None (maybe the occasional blind cave fish). It's about the geology. All levels with a certified guide. Good buoyancy is a must.

See what I mean? Your perfect match is in there. If you want warm, easy, and colorful, stick to the Caribbean. If you want wild, big, and thrilling, look to the Pacific. And if you want something completely different, a day in the cenotes is unforgettable.Mexico diving spots

Timing is Everything: When to Go for the Best Conditions

You can dive year-round in Mexico, but the experience changes.

Caribbean Side: The peak season is roughly December to April. This is when the weather is driest and sunniest. But it's also the most crowded and expensive. Summer and fall are warmer, water is calmer, but you have a higher chance of rain and the very small possibility of a hurricane (mostly Sept-Oct). Honestly, I prefer the shoulder seasons (May-June, November). Fewer people, better prices, and the diving is still fantastic.

Pacific Side: For sea lions and whale sharks in La Paz, late summer through spring is best. For the massive pelagics in Socorro, the prime season is November to May, when the ocean is calmer. Winter months can bring humpback whales to both areas.

Pro Tip: Always check the specific animal seasons. Want to see bull sharks in Playa? Go between November and March. Dreaming of humpbacks in Socorro? January to March is your window. Planning your trip around these events can make it extra special.scuba diving Mexico

Answering Your Burning Questions (The FAQ Section)

I get asked these all the time. Let's clear them up.

Q: I'm a new diver with less than 20 dives. Where should I go for the best diving in Mexico?

A: Cozumel, hands down. The conditions are forgiving, the diving is easy and beautiful, and the dive operators are supremely experienced with beginners. Stick to the shallower reefs and communicate your experience level. The cenotes are also accessible with a guide if your buoyancy is decent.

Q: Is diving in Mexico safe?

A: Generally, yes. The dive industry is well-established. However, safety comes down to you and your choice of operator. Always choose a reputable shop—look for PADI 5-Star or SSI recognized facilities. Don't be afraid to ask about their safety protocols, boat equipment, and guide-to-diver ratios. Check their tanks and gear yourself. Your safety is your responsibility too. For official tourism safety info, you can refer to the Mexico Tourism Board website.

Q: How much does it cost?

A: It varies wildly. In Cozumel or Playa, a standard two-tank boat dive can run $90-$130 USD. Cenote dives are similar. In the Pacific, prices are comparable. A 10-day Socorro liveaboard is a different beast, costing $5,000 to $7,000+. Always ask what's included: gear? marine park fees? snacks? tips?best diving in Mexico

Q: Do I need to speak Spanish?

A: Not for diving. In major dive hubs, all instruction and briefings are available in English (and often other languages). However, learning a few basic phrases is always appreciated and enhances the experience.

Q: What about conservation? Is the reef healthy?

A: It's a mixed bag. Some reefs, like in Cozumel, are protected within a National Marine Park (the CONANP oversees many protected areas), which helps. You pay a park fee, and rules are enforced (no touching, no gloves). You'll see healthy, vibrant sections. But you'll also see areas affected by bleaching, disease, or past hurricane damage. It's a reminder to be a responsible diver—practice perfect buoyancy, use reef-safe sunscreen, and choose operators who prioritize the environment.

Making it Happen: Final Tips Before You Book

Research operators, don't just pick the cheapest.

Read recent reviews on multiple platforms. Look for comments about boat maintenance, guide attentiveness, and group size.

Get dive insurance.

Seriously. DAN or similar. A chamber ride is expensive.

Brush up on your skills.

If it's been a while, consider a refresher course locally or do one your first day. It makes everything more enjoyable.

Pack for both worlds.

A 3mm wetsuit for the Caribbean, a 5mm+ for the Pacific. A reef hook is useful for Socorro. A good dive computer is essential.

So, what's the verdict on the best diving in Mexico?

There isn't one single answer. The beauty of Mexico is that it offers a "best" for every type of diver. For consistent, beautiful, accessible diving that makes you smile, Cozumel is unbeatable. For raw, heart-pounding encounters with ocean giants, save up for Socorro. For a unique blend of reef, cenote, and culture, the Riviera Maya is perfect. And for playful sea lions and a laid-back vibe, La Paz delivers.

My personal favorite? It's a split. Nothing beats the joy of a perfect Cozumel drift dive where everything goes right. But the memory of a 20-foot manta ray hovering inches above my head in Socorro is burned into my brain forever. You really can't go wrong.

The best diving in Mexico is waiting. You just have to decide what kind of story you want to tell when you surface.